custom screwdriver

A custom screwdriver represents the pinnacle of precision tool engineering, designed to meet specific user requirements and applications that standard screwdrivers cannot adequately address. Unlike mass-produced tools, a custom screwdriver is meticulously crafted with tailored specifications, incorporating unique blade configurations, specialized handle designs, and premium materials selected for particular tasks. The main functions of a custom screwdriver extend far beyond basic fastening operations, encompassing precision assembly work, specialized maintenance procedures, and intricate repair tasks across various industries. These tools feature advanced technological elements including ergonomically engineered handles with optimized grip textures, precision-forged tips manufactured to exacting tolerances, and specialized coatings that enhance durability and performance. The blade geometry of a custom screwdriver can be modified to accommodate unique screw head designs, unusual access angles, or specific torque requirements that standard tools cannot handle effectively. Custom screwdrivers find applications in aerospace manufacturing, where precision and reliability are paramount, electronics assembly requiring delicate handling of sensitive components, automotive repair involving specialized fasteners, medical device maintenance demanding sterile and precise tools, and jewelry making where intricate work requires exceptional control. The technological features of these specialized tools often include anti-slip handle surfaces, magnetized tips for component retention, corrosion-resistant finishes, and precisely calibrated dimensions that ensure perfect fit with designated fasteners. Manufacturing processes for custom screwdrivers involve advanced metallurgy techniques, computer-controlled machining, and rigorous quality testing protocols that guarantee consistent performance. The customization process allows users to specify exact blade lengths, handle diameters, tip configurations, and material compositions based on their unique operational requirements, resulting in tools that deliver superior performance compared to standard alternatives.

Precision-Engineered Blade Technology

Precision-Engineered Blade Technology

The blade technology incorporated in a custom screwdriver represents a revolutionary advancement in tool precision and performance, setting new standards for accuracy and reliability in fastening applications. This sophisticated engineering approach begins with the selection of premium-grade steel alloys that undergo specialized heat treatment processes to achieve optimal hardness and toughness characteristics. The custom screwdriver blade is manufactured using computer-controlled precision machining techniques that maintain tolerances measured in thousandths of an inch, ensuring perfect dimensional accuracy and consistency across every tool produced. The tip geometry is meticulously calculated and shaped to provide maximum contact area with fastener heads while minimizing the risk of cam-out or strip-out, which are common problems with standard screwdrivers. Advanced surface treatments applied to the custom screwdriver blade include specialized coatings that enhance wear resistance, reduce friction, and provide superior corrosion protection, extending tool life significantly beyond conventional alternatives. The blade manufacturing process incorporates quality control measures that include laser measurement systems, hardness testing, and performance validation protocols that guarantee each custom screwdriver meets exacting specifications. This precision-engineered blade technology enables the custom screwdriver to maintain its sharp, accurate profile even after thousands of use cycles, providing consistent performance throughout its extended service life. The custom nature of the blade allows for unique configurations such as compound angles for accessing recessed fasteners, specialized tip shapes for proprietary screw designs, or extended lengths for deep-set applications that standard tools cannot reach effectively. Users benefit from the superior engagement characteristics that prevent fastener damage and ensure reliable torque transmission, making the custom screwdriver an invaluable asset for precision work where standard tools would compromise quality or create safety risks.
Ergonomic Handle Innovation

Ergonomic Handle Innovation

The ergonomic handle design of a custom screwdriver represents a paradigm shift in tool comfort and user experience, incorporating advanced biomechanical principles and cutting-edge materials science to create handles that optimize human performance while minimizing fatigue and injury risk. This innovative approach begins with comprehensive analysis of hand anatomy and grip dynamics, resulting in handle profiles that naturally conform to the human hand and distribute forces evenly across contact surfaces. The custom screwdriver handle features carefully calculated diameter variations that accommodate different grip styles and hand sizes, while textured surfaces provide secure grip even in challenging conditions involving moisture, oils, or other contaminants. Advanced polymer materials used in custom screwdriver handles offer superior durability compared to traditional materials while providing enhanced comfort through temperature insulation and vibration dampening properties. The ergonomic design incorporates strategic placement of grip zones that guide proper hand positioning, reducing wrist strain and enabling more efficient torque application. Custom screwdriver handles can be tailored to specific user requirements, including left-handed configurations, oversized grips for users with arthritis or other hand conditions, or specialized shapes for unique application requirements. The manufacturing process for these innovative handles includes compression molding techniques that create seamless, robust construction without weak points or failure-prone joints common in standard screwdriver designs. Color coding and identification systems can be integrated directly into the custom screwdriver handle during manufacturing, providing visual organization systems that improve workflow efficiency in professional environments. The handle design also incorporates features such as integrated bit storage, magnetic components for small parts retention, or specialized mounting systems that enable secure tool storage and organization. Users experience dramatically reduced hand fatigue during extended use periods, improved control and accuracy, and enhanced safety through better grip security, making the custom screwdriver an essential tool for professionals who demand the highest levels of performance and comfort.
Application-Specific Customization

Application-Specific Customization

Application-specific customization capabilities distinguish the custom screwdriver as the ultimate solution for specialized industrial, commercial, and professional requirements that cannot be addressed by standard off-the-shelf tools. This comprehensive customization approach enables the creation of tools perfectly matched to unique operational challenges, environmental conditions, and performance requirements across diverse industries and applications. The custom screwdriver can be engineered with specific dimensional requirements including precise blade lengths for accessing fasteners in confined spaces, unique angles for approaching fasteners at unusual orientations, or specialized tip configurations designed to work exclusively with proprietary fastener systems. Material selection for application-specific custom screwdrivers takes into account environmental factors such as chemical exposure, temperature extremes, electromagnetic interference, or sterilization requirements, ensuring optimal performance and longevity in challenging operational conditions. For electronics applications, the custom screwdriver can incorporate anti-static properties, non-magnetic characteristics, and precisely controlled tip dimensions that prevent damage to sensitive components while providing reliable fastening capability. Aerospace applications benefit from custom screwdrivers engineered to meet stringent quality standards and traceability requirements, with materials and manufacturing processes certified to aerospace specifications and documented through comprehensive quality systems. Medical device applications require custom screwdrivers that can withstand repeated sterilization cycles while maintaining dimensional stability and performance characteristics, often incorporating biocompatible materials and specialized surface treatments. The customization process includes comprehensive consultation services that analyze specific application requirements and recommend optimal design parameters, materials, and features to maximize tool effectiveness and user satisfaction. Quality assurance protocols for application-specific custom screwdrivers include rigorous testing procedures that validate performance under actual operating conditions, ensuring reliable functionality when deployed in critical applications. This level of customization enables organizations to standardize on tools that perfectly match their specific requirements, reducing training time, improving work quality, and minimizing the risk of tool-related failures or accidents that could result in costly downtime or safety incidents.
